Añadir al carritoHardcover. Condición: Very Good. Various Ilustrador. 2nd Edition. Cream paper covered boards, white cloth spine, gilt decoration, 4to. Pages not numbered, Prelims in polish followed by introduction in polish, french and english ( 5pp each ), polish introduction by Jaromir Celakovsky. Each has a list of illustrations to follow, these are a total of 30 patterned tissue guarded tipped in plates, mostly black and white but several coloured views of Prague, works of art etc ( all present ). The gilt decoration on the cover is by J Simak, and is partially rubbed. Cover leading margin a little worn and faintly marked, with some surface loss to lower corner. Letterpress and graphics in prelims printed in red and black inks, and is attributed to Dr E Gregor and Son. There is some sort of tie in to the School of Crafts in Prague but I can`t quite make out the wording to translate adequately. The dedication ? page preceding the title page is signed in black ink by a J Schmottic ? perhaps, this is adjacent to a stamp for what translates as The Board of Continuing Trade Schools in Prague. The first edition was issued in 1911 as far as I can see. Clean and tight, if a bit rubbed to cover. About VG.
